Excerpt from Taylor's Modern Navigation The part relating to the finding of the deviation of the compass will be found to fit any case, no matter what the class of vessel. This section is important, owing to the use of iron and steel in the construction of modern vessels. This part also contains a de scription of the different kinds of Pelorus and other instruments used in the taking of bearings, and azimuths, with rules for using the same, written in very plain language, - very necessary knowl edge for the bridge officer. Chart-work and coast navigation has been thoroughly gone over, and many matters connected with the same, not generally known to seamen, have been introduced, especially those matters relating to the proper application and use of deviation when taking bear ings and finding the course to steer.
